Flag of ZimbabweZimbabwean Prime Minister Morgan Tsvangirai has been drawn into another scandal, this time involving alleged theft of $1.5 million funds allocated to his office for the construction of his official residence in Harare.

Less than a month after he was accused of being connected to a bribery scandal involving alleged use of money to buy local editors, Tsvangirai is now accused of misappropriating $1.5 million in public funds released by the Reserve Bank of Zimbabwe in 2009 meant to buy a house in an up-market Harare suburb.

State radio reported on Tuesday that the Premier is likely to face fraud charges amid allegations that he “double-dipped” by accessing $1.5 million from the RBZ and a similar amount from the Ministry of Finance for the same purpose.

The house, a double story mansion, is currently under renovations to ensure it meets standard quarters for a Premier.

However, observers say the accusations are part of a plot by hardline elements in Zimbabwe’s shaky coalition government who want to quicken the collapse of the three-year-old "marriage" of convenience between Tsvangirai and long-serving President Robert Mugabe.

The same hardliners wanted the Odinga probed early this month over allegations that he bribed editors of three private newspapers to write positively about his party and personal life.
